It definately looks nice, and though not one of the MOST useful ships, it does have some potential for lowsec PI activities, and makes for a decent entry level (PI only) hauler. While it only sports a 100 m3 regular cargo bay, if you right click it, you can open a 1000 m3 PI goods cargo bay or a 1600 m3 Command Center only bay. 1000 m3 is decent for a starting character who hasnt had the time or inclination to train up industrials yet.
Also, look at a few of the other characteristics:
This is a cruiser sized ship with Defensive capabilities and Mass/Agility to match, but with the addition of an only 30 m sig radius, which puts it somewhere in the lock time / targetability of a shuttle. It also has a low 300 second recharge rate on its cruiser level shields, which isnt too shabby.
With its 4 low slots, consider this basic example (Again, im not saying its a "great" ship, but it does have SOME potential):
2 Warp Core Stabilizers 1 400 mm plate 1 Medium Armor Repairer
Not only do you have the ability to pass up some basic single or double pointing pirate gangs, but you will be hard to shoot at and target to boot. Plus with the slightly expanded armor capacity and a repairer, you might just have enough time to escape.
Or consider tossing on a Damage control instead of the armor or the repper for some decent structure buffer.
Just some thoughts

Ship is useless, compare it to an Exequror with gallente cruiser at lv4, and 3 x expander II.
It holds 1741m3, sig radius is 120 and you can fit ECM, cloak, drones, rigs ect.
I would advise any newer characters to offload this crud, buy an exequror, pocket the change and spend your free skill points training for gallente cruiser.
